Sharding the Hollowgate profile store happens in three passes: dual-write, verify, cutover. Don't rush the verify pass — last time we skipped the checksum sweep and spent a weekend reconciling avatars. The resharder tool handles dual-writes automatically once you tag the release as shard-ready. It reads shard maps from the internal topology service, which needs its own credential; for this rollout, use the key below.

service key, tadup-tahog: zpat7_wB1tnEL

## Deploying the Gatewick Proctor Queue

Deploys are pretty painless: push to main, wait for the pipeline, then watch the queue drain dashboard for five minutes. If candidates pile up mid-exam, roll back first and ask questions later — the queue replays safely. Everything the workers care about lives in one config block, shown here for reference.

settings of bafof-yagef:
JOROX_PIN=8740
JOROX_TENANT=pelox
JOROX_METRICS_HOST=metrics.jorox.qorvelworks.internal
JOROX_SEAL=seal_c78f63c1
JOROX_STANDBY_TEAM=norax

## Releases

Dedupewell releases are cut from `main` on the first Tuesday of each month. Tag the commit, run the full alert-replay suite, and verify the deduplication rate against the golden dataset before publishing. Every release artifact must be signed so downstream installers can verify provenance. Sign the tarball with the release signing key below.

rollout seal: bky4_x7Gc